Senior Electrical Engineer- Owners Engineering, Development Engineering & Quality Assurance

Company: Pure Power Engineering
Location: Hoboken
Posted on: March 16, 2023

Job Description:

Description:Pure Power Engineering is seeking an experienced Electrical Engineer to join our Owners Engineering group, specializing in owners engineering, development engineering and quality assurance to provide Nationwide engineering services for investors, owners and financiers of commercial and utility scale solar PV and energy storage projects. This person will possess a wide range of knowledge & experience, in the development, design, installation, & operation of commercial and utility scale solar PV & energy storage systems. About Pure Power Engineering & the Owners Engineering team Pure Power Engineering utilizes our unrivaled solar + storage expertise to provide high quality engineering that maximize generation revenue and reduce costs, enabling our clients to scale up by completing solar + storage projects faster and more profitably. We provide clients with the services and confidence they need to replace fossil fuels and lead the world's transition to sustainable energy. PPEs Owners Engineering (OE) team provides engineering support for investors, owners, and financiers of commercial and utility scale solar + storage projects. Our owner's engineering team ensures client success & maximum profitability by being a trusted advisor in technical risk management and delivery support throughout project development, construction, and operation. Responsibilities Review & quality assurance (primary responsibilities) Conduct technical due diligence on designs by third party EORs, as well as projects designed in-house with Pure Power.Review drawings, reports, RFIs, submittals, & contracts. Technology evaluation and risk assessment. Create reports of findings with photos, descriptions, severity, and recommendations. Interface with owners/stakeholders as a consultant who assesses technical and financial risk for their projects. Assist in determining the financial impact on performance or cost to remedy. Work with the installers/contractors to ensure they understand the problems and solutions to the issues you identified.Providing background research on technical questions both for internal use and for clients. Energy Modeling & ValidationGenerate PVsyst models & evaluate 3rd party models, performance guarantee calculations, climate adjusted actual vs expected, etc. Gathering actual performance data, filtering it, and performing a wide array of analysis including PR, ASTM capacity tests, and climate adjusted actual vs expected. Development Engineering Planning, conceptual designs, interconnection, equipment selection, and energy models. Field Engineering (less than 5% of time) Conduct the on-site visual inspections for workmanship, code compliance, and best practices. Construction monitoring site visits, reporting on QC issues and overall progress of construction vs schedule. Leadership & Subject Matter Expert Elevate the technical capabilities of the organization. Contribute to a centralized knowledge base for others in the company to use. Develop training programs such as best practices, troubleshooting procedures, and equipment use. Mastery of the NEC and other codes and standards applicable to solar and energy storage systems. Create standardized forms the engineers will use in the field. Create methods to digitize all forms, so that they can be quickly turned into a deliverable report. Mastery of the National Electrical Code as applicable to solar and energy storage systems. Technology evaluation and risk assessment. Communication - Ability to be a point of contact for client(s) projects. Manage relationships with project stakeholders, including project owner & investors, off-takers, equipment vendors, etc. Execution of work - Manage the parallel execution of multiple projects in various stages Other tasks as assigned. Requirements:Required Qualifications Bachelor's Degree in Electrical Engineer or a similar discipline Considered an SME for commercial and utility scale energy storage AND solar PV Proficiency with AutoCAD, PVsyst, SKM, & Etap software Able to take highly technical issues and communicate them in a manner that can be understood by non-technical clients Familiarity with the National Electrical Code (NEC)Preferred Qualifications5+ years' experience in solar engineering and PV industry MS in electrical engineering, or other related discipline NABCEP PV Installation Professional Certificate Professional engineering (PE) license Medium Voltage engineering experience. Experience designing energy storage systems Hands on experience commissioning, testing, and troubleshooting solar PV systems.
